Electromagnetic Induction(电磁感应) usually provides high power levels which can provide output of several watts (W) to several hundred KW. Large amounts of power can be transmitted by electromagnetic induction, but receiver must be located adjacent to the transmitter which means the terminal must have a battery. The effective range is probably 1cm or less.

Resonance technology(磁共振) shares parts of both electromagnetic induction and radio reception, and would be appropriate in direct power supply to devices without batteries. It can directly supplies devices moving within a fixed area and provide max power of several KW also range of several meters.
Radio reception can only transmit about several dozen mW, making it impossible to recharge a handset in an hour or two, but sufficient to handle mobile phone stand-by power requirement. It is good for terminals for long stand-by times, with continuous charging in rooms.
